Karateka from Balashikha won bronze at the world championship in Japan
Moscow region athlete Anzhelika Ovcharenko became the bronze medalist of the world championship in Kyokushin karate in Japan. This was reported by the press service of the Moscow Region Ministry of Sports.
– I went out and did what we worked out with sensei. Then they announced that I went to the second round, it went just as easily and quickly. I didn’t even realize how I was already standing on a pedestal. I immediately called the coach and relatives to convey the good news. Now there is a great desire to move on, – Angelica shared after the victory.
It is noted that the athlete competed in the adult age category (15-34 years). More than 30 athletes competed for the status of the champion of the competition in this group.
Angelica is a ward of the Balashikha sports school “Orion”.
